Where wilder creatures

A blue grey sky behind the willow tree
Almost dusk,it’s neither night nor day
Bare branches wave in timeless ecstasy

From high above, a forest is a sea
Where wilder creatures in their strange haunts play
Such dark grey sky behind the willow tree

Seems like nature’s making a strong plea
We’re joined as one yet separate in our ways
Bare branches show  their timeless ecstasy

I wish  to  see like a  wild falcon sees
I wish to pray like ancient saints might pray
To gods who dance within a shuddering tree

O exchange places with a lively bee
With nectar, pollen, golden dust to lay.
Bare branches share  their timeless ecstasy

I saw the sea from cliffs above Lyme Bay
I saw the lights from far,so far away
A blue grey sky delights the willow tree
Bare branches rave in holy ecstasy
